A Study on Tiredness Measurement using Computer Vision

Abstract: In this paper, we studied tiredness measurement based on several different detection methods in real time. We know that the driver tiredness is one of the major causes of traffic accidents. So tiredness detection can play a vital role for preventing road accidents. By developing an automatic solution for alerting drivers of tiredness before an accident occurs, this could reduce the number of traffic accidents.
